The Triune Stone's Final Revelation
In the heart of the ancient forest, where the whispers of the past mingled with the rustling leaves, stood an ancient stone, its surface etched with symbols that defied the passage of time. The Triune Stone, as it was known, was said to hold the secrets of the universe, a testament to the interconnectedness of all things. For centuries, seekers had traveled from the farthest corners of the world, driven by a singular quest: to unlock the stone's mysteries and understand the true nature of their existence.
Amara had been one such seeker. Her journey had been long and arduous, filled with trials and tribulations that tested her resolve and her understanding of the world. She had traveled through deserts and climbed mountains, her heart burning with the desire to uncover the truth that lay hidden within the Triune Stone.
As she stood before the stone, her eyes traced the intricate patterns, each symbol a puzzle piece waiting to be placed. She had learned much from the stone's teachings, but the final piece remained elusive. The stone had revealed to her the existence of the Three Selves: the Ego, the Soul, and the Spirit. Each represented a different aspect of her being, and understanding their interplay was crucial to unlocking the stone's final secret.
One evening, as the sun dipped below the horizon, casting a golden glow over the forest, Amara felt a sudden surge of energy. The stone seemed to pulse with a life of its own, and she knew that the time for revelation was at hand. She reached out, her fingers brushing against the cool, smooth surface, and felt a strange connection to the stone's ancient wisdom.
"The Ego seeks power, the Soul seeks knowledge, and the Spirit seeks unity," the stone's voice echoed in her mind, its tone both soothing and commanding. "But they are one, and you must find the balance between them."
Amara's mind raced with the implications of the stone's words. She realized that the balance between the Three Selves was not just a metaphor; it was a literal truth. The stone was not just a physical object; it was a representation of the interconnectedness of all existence.
She closed her eyes, focusing on the stone, and felt a surge of energy course through her veins. The symbols on the stone began to glow, their light blending into a single, radiant aura that enveloped her. She felt herself being pulled into a realm beyond the physical, a place where the boundaries between the Ego, the Soul, and the Spirit were blurred.
In this realm, Amara saw visions of her past, present, and future. She saw the choices she had made, the consequences of those choices, and the potential paths that lay ahead. She understood that the true power of the Triune Stone was not in its ability to reveal secrets, but in its ability to guide her to a deeper understanding of herself.
As she opened her eyes, she felt a profound sense of clarity. She understood that the balance between the Three Selves was not about controlling them, but about embracing them all. The Ego was necessary for survival, the Soul for growth, and the Spirit for connection.
With this newfound understanding, Amara felt a shift within herself. The weight of her quest seemed to lift, replaced by a sense of peace and purpose. She knew that her journey was far from over, but she also knew that she had found the strength to face whatever lay ahead.
The Triune Stone, now a part of her being, continued to guide her. She realized that the true mystery was not in the stone itself, but in the journey to understand its teachings. The stone had revealed to her that the essence of the self was a continuous process of growth and discovery.
As Amara walked away from the ancient stone, she felt a sense of unity with the world around her. She understood that she was not alone in her quest for understanding, and that the interconnectedness of all things was a powerful force that could be harnessed for good.
The Triune Stone's final revelation had changed Amara forever. She had discovered that the true power of the self lay in the balance and harmony of the Three Selves, and that the journey to understanding oneself was a lifelong quest filled with wonder and discovery.
